Overview

The Engineering Project Leader is responsible for managing integration, design and development of brake and clutch products across a wide portfolio. The candidate will provide technical leadership and support for the refinement and assimilation of products into the Regal Rexnord Business System (RBS) using practices of CI, 80/20, VAVE and NPD. Candidates likely to succeed in the role will have strong product application for electromechanical products and processes, They will have mastery of product realization and abilities to envision product potential and capability.

This collaborative role will provide multiple opportunities to partner across EMCB sites in the U.S. or across the globe with 2-4 focused engagements that may extend over 6-12 months each. Most assignments will be supported virtually and require occasional travel 5-15% depending upon project and core team needs. The role will be based in South Beloit from our Advanced Development site during the rotational period.

Candidates will ultimately land within a team, product or location that best maps personal strengths, organizational needs and personal interests after several assignments.

Major Responsibilities
  • Manages technical content for a highly configured electro-mechanical brake portfolio
  • Interacts with engineers, sales, product managers, operations, end customers and other cross functional roles to translates needs into product definition.
  • Leads the design and integration of new and established products for targeted growth verticals and key customers
  • Interacts with sales team and customers to resolve application issues with occasional travel when needed.
  • Takes responsibility for and completes key tasks on a project-by-project basis. Drives to meet deadlines ensuring customer success
  • Creates test plans to validate design concepts and material or manufacturing changes, summarizing results and documenting conclusions with other engineers
  • Resolve challenges related to the interpretation of drawings, design tolerances, quality and material requirements based upon application needs
  • Works closely with operations team members to establish KPI’s and other work standards.
  • Conducts portfolio analysis of incumbent, new and competitor clutches and brakes
  • Active observer and steward to assure products are applied and maintained in diverse and challenging environments.
  • Project management leader, facilitator or contributor responsibilities at any given time.
Required Education / Experience / Skills
  • Bachelor's degree Mechanical, Electrical Engineering or Engineering Technology equivalent from an accredited university. A business degree with hands-on or military experience will be considered.
  • 5 + years experience in product or process development with highly configured industrial products. Directly applicable internships and accomplishments may be credited toward professional experience.
  • Understanding of Engineering BOMs and drawings
  • Working familiarity with CRM, PDM and Solid Works CAD software preferred
  • Proficient in MS Office.
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ills that convey visualization with concise and clear explanation.
  • Experience working in a cross-functional, collaborative environment and/or global centers of excellence.
  • Ability to work in a fast-paced environment and able to effectively problem solve, prioritize, and execute tasks with a sense of urgency
  • Experience in high reliability, industrial automation or export-controlled products desirable.
  • US persons only.
